Meet the superintendent

Dr. Mark Wenzel

Dr. Mark Wenzel became superintendent of Methow Valley School District in August 2008. He previously served for six years as communications director in Bethel School District near Tacoma, WA.

Other career highlights include teaching junior high, high school and college in the U.S. and Asia, working as a broadcast journalist in Korea and serving as a public information officer in the state legislature.

He received a bachelor's degree from Earlham College (Japanese Studies), master's degrees from University of Washington (International Studies) and London School of Economics (Media/Communications) and a doctorate from University of Washington (Education Leadership).

Dr. Wenzel's focus in Methow Valley School District is to improve student achievement through improved instruction. He is working closely with staff to examine curriculum, create a balanced assessment system and use research-based instructional practices to maximize learning for each student in the system.

Dr. Wenzel lives in Twisp, WA with his wife, Julie, and their six-month old daughter, Ruby. His hobbies include theater, music, tennis, reading and eating Indian food.
